TELCON
Volpe/Kissinger
4:07 pm
5/21/70
V: I was in a conference which I wound up quickly.
K: I'm returning your call of yesterday. Sorry I didn't call sooner.
V: If your days are anything like mine with Cambodia piles on top, I know it's
very heavy. Some time back you said the President had approved for me to
visit the Soviet Union.
K: He didn't approve a time.
V: That's what I'm calling about kx now. I only want to suggest that if 1)
should I make such a trip that it would seem to me you wouldn't go without
taking in other East. European countries and 2)? ? ? ? ? ? ? The
Ambasssador in Romania has asked me several times to come -- they are
very interested in road construction.
K: On the Soviet Union give us 10 days after Dobrynin is back to see what they
say. Romania is fine.
V: Besides Romania and Yugolavia we have no arrangement with Poland but
the Ambassador from Poland to the U.S.
K: We have no problem with East European countries.
V: Czechoslovakia or Bulgaria wouldn't be wise. Let me work on a time frame.
There are times when I have to be here. My present plans XXXX indicate that
I could make this trip about the first 10 days in Aug. That's my timetable but
it may agree or may not.
K: With Eastern Europe you can do that on your own. The Soviet Union I will
let you know in two weeks.
V: That would give us two mont hs to make arangements if we decided to include
the Soviet Union.
K: The issues are entirely foreign policy and has nothing to do with your dept.
V: You will give us your determination and we will go with or without the S. U.
